- The top reasons for opposing ‘adding a new westbound bus lane’ are fears that changes will make things worse (46%), and that proposed changes are unnecessary (35%)
- Respondents who oppose ‘improving the existing roundabout’ mostly comment that the idea is a waste of money and unnecessary (62%). Almost a quarter of those opposing left no comment (24%)
- The top reason for opposing ‘adding dedicated cycle paths along Lake Road’ is a concern that plans will make things worse – such as congestion, traffic, and the lanes being too narrow (38%)
- Respondents who oppose ‘improving the landscaping in the area’ do so because they believe the changes are unnecessary; that the area is not used enough, or there are already of plenty green areas (61%)
An asterisk (*) indicates a very small base size, caution should be taken when interpreting the results
